2024 Compare Cities Job Market:
Newark, OH vs Blue Ridge, GA

Change Cities
Highlights
- Job Growth in Blue Ridge has been positive.
- Blue Ridge has 1.2% more unemployment than Newark.
- Blue Ridge job growth has increased by 16.1% in the past 10 years.
 Newark, OHBlue Ridge, GAUnited States
 Current Unemployment4.0%2.8%6.0%
 Future Job Growth35.5%52.3%33.5%
 Recent Job Growth-3.3%-5.0%-6.2%
 3 Yr. Job Growth-0.9%-0.1%-3.6%
 5 Yr. Job Growth2.9%12.5%-0.7%
 10 Yr. Job Growth6.5%16.1%6.3%
